Located 24 km south of Geraldton and 400 km north of Perth (via the Brand Highway), Greenough is one of the most interesting historical towns in Australia. Claimed by some to be the country's best preserved nineteenth century town.

Today the heart of Greenough - a collection of eleven buildings including the gaol, courthouse, police station, churches, and school - is administered by the National Trust and open from 9.00 am - 4.45 pm daily.
